 REHABCARE AND HOWARD REGIONAL HEALTH SYSTEM ANNOUNCE STRATEGIC PARTNERSHIP FOR
                             REHABILITATION SERVICES
                 - Will Provide Full Post-Acute Delivery System
                          - in North Central Indiana -

ST. LOUIS, MO and KOKOMO, IN, November 1, 2004--RehabCare Group, Inc. (NYSE:RHB)
and the Board of Trustees of Howard  Community  Hospital  d/b/a Howard  Regional
Health System today have announced their intention to form a joint venture which
will own and operate Howard Regional Health System West Campus, a rehabilitation
hospital  providing  physical  rehabilitation  services in Kokomo, IN. Financial
terms were not disclosed.

     Based in Kokomo, IN, Howard Regional Health System has provided exceptional
healthcare  to Howard County since 1961.  Howard  Regional has 180 licensed beds
and  serves a  9-county  service  area with over  1,400  staff,  physicians  and
licensed  healthcare  professionals.  In  April  2004  it  acquired  the  former
HealthSouth  Rehabilitation  Hospital  of Kokomo,  now known as Howard  Regional
Health System West Campus Specialty  Hospital ("West Campus").  West Campus is a
30-bed  hospital  offering  rehabilitation  services to patients  suffering from
stroke, disabling injuries and other trauma-related illnesses.

     The joint venture,  which is expected to be finalized in January 2005, will
acquire the  operations of West Campus.  RehabCare  will, in turn,  enter into a
management  agreement with the joint venture to manage the acute  rehabilitation
hospital.  In addition,  the joint venture will identify a long-term  acute care
hospital (LTACH) provider to own and operate an LTACH in a remaining  portion of
the West Campus.  It is expected  that when fully  operational,  the West Campus
facility  will add 30  long-term  acute care beds to its  existing 30  inpatient
acute care rehabilitation beds.
